How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Shawnee?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
New Shawnee Studio Apartments | $1,363 | $1,003 | $3,087 |
New Shawnee 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,738 | $845 | $7,766 |
New Shawnee 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,128 | $995 | $10,000+ |
New Shawnee 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,362 | $1,361 | $10,000+ |
New Shawnee 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,778 | $1,955 | $3,569 |

Frequently Asked Questions about New Shawnee Apartments
What is the Cheapest New apartment in Shawnee?
Currently the most affordable New Apartment in Shawnee is at Hedge Lane Apartments listed at $1,045.
How much is the average rent for a New Shawnee Apartment?
The average rent for a New Apartment in Shawnee is $2,196.
What is the largest New Shawnee Apartment for rent?
Today's New apartment with the most square footage in Shawnee is a 1,640 square feet unit starting from $1,258 at Domain City Center.
What is the average size for Shawnee New Apartments for rent?
The average size for a New rental in Shawnee is currently at 679 sq ft.
